Recap - Wings Defeat New York 81-71

Arike Ogunbowale scored 21 points leading the Wings to a 81-71 victory over New York at Barclays Center on Sunday.

Dallas was the ATS victor, as they covered the +2.0-point spread as an underdog. Over-Under bettors who played UNDER the total of 164.5 were rewarded at the payout window.

Isabelle Harrison had 18 points for Dallas and Marina Mabrey chipped in with 14 points. Kayla Thornton had 4 assists for the Wings, while Kayla Thornton was the team's top rebounder, grabbing 10 boards.

The Liberty got a 17-point performance from Sabrina Ionescu, who was supported by 14 points from Natasha Howard. Sabrina Ionescu had 6 assists in a losing cause for New York, while Natasha Howard grabbed 8 rebounds.

Dallas led at halftime, 39-37.

Dallas won the battle of the boards, outrebounding their counterparts 33-28.
